Learn about the relationship between stress and diseases with this free course on biology and human behavior psychology.

This psychology course being by covering the classical conditioning theory, also known as the respondent or Pavlovian conditioning theory. You will learn about the ethical issues in conditioning human behaviour, along with the key terms and the main elements in this principle. The course will then cover the operant conditioning theory, which overviews the practice of learning and punishment. Through these lessons, you will become familiar with the essential topics of learning theory, learning by insight, and learning set.

Next, you will study topics related to the states of consciousness. These will include waking consciousness and its characteristics, controlled and automatic processes, and the patterns of the four stages of sleep including their characteristics, dream types, and the effects of sleep deprivation. You will also learn about daydreaming, pain, and the purpose of sleep. Bringing this all together, you will then learn about the biological basis for behaviour, stress, and the relationship between stress and diseases.
